Summary
This observational study with circulating tumor cells (CTC) count, isolation and analysis at several time points during disease progression is to investigate the role and biology of CTCs and clusters of CTCs in different cancer types. It also evaluates the role of CTCs as biomarkers, and aims at the identification of key signaling networks that are active in CTCs.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| OTHER | Blood samples | Blood samples (3 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id (EDTA) tubes with a volume of 7.5 ml blood each) will be processed for CTC isolation and characterization, ranging from molecular analysis to culture and drug screen. |
| OTHER | Samples from tumor draining vessels | In case of tumor resection, 3 EDTA tubes (5 ml) will be withdrawn from the tumor draining vessels for CTC isolation and characterization, ranging from molecular analysis to culture and drug screen. |
